React Native

What are the best practices for optimizing performance in React Native Apps?

The question is about React Native .

Answer:

The best practices to improve React Native app performance include minimising re-rendering with React.memo and shouldComponentUpdate, using FlatList for large lists, and avoiding heavy tasks on the main thread. Using Native Modules for critical tasks and libraries like FastImage for images also contributes. Regularly profile the app with tools like React Native Performance Monitor to identify and fix slow points.

Related React Native Questions And Answers

Ready to Hire?

Hire trusted React Native devs from Ukraine & Europe in 48h

Skip the hiring headaches and get trusted React Native developers who deliver results. Cortance has helped startups scale to million-dollar success stories.

Cortance developer 1Cortance developer 2Cortance developer 3

Find your perfect React Native tech match

Abrham is a skilled Full stack Javascript developer with 5 years of experience in various software frameworks and programming languages. He specializes in JavaScript, React.js, React Native, and Nest.js, effectively managing ... Read More

Level
Senior
Availability
40 h/w
Experience
5 yrs.
English
C2

Stanly is a skilled Full Stack Developer with six years of experience, proficient in JavaScript, React.js, and Node.js. He has developed comprehensive solutions using frameworks like Next.js, React Native, and Express.js whil... Read More

Level
Middle
Availability
40 h/w
Experience
6 yrs.
English
C2

Albert is a skilled Software Engineer with 5 years of experience in frontend development. He specializes in frameworks like React.js, React Native, and Node.js, alongside programming languages such as TypeScript. His expertis... Read More

Level
Senior
Availability
40 h/w
Experience
5 yrs.
English
B2
Victoriia S.

Victoriia is a skilled Flutter Developer with 4 years of experience in mobile application development. She specializes in frameworks such as Flutter, leveraging JavaScript, DART, and utilizes databases like MySQL and Firebase... Read More

Level
Senior
Availability
20 - 30 h/w
Experience
10 yrs.
English
C1
Cortance 5-star rating on ClutchCortance 5-star rating on GoodFirms
Andrew Biter
COO

Cortance was able to supplement the client's organization with highly-qualified professionals. The team was consistently efficient from a project management standpoint, and internal stakeholders were particularly impressed with the vendor's supportiveness, responsiveness, and agility of delivery.

Clutch
5.0/5.0
Igor Dorosh
Customer Success Manager

With Cortance's support, the client has improved project timing and caught up with their planned schedule. Cortance has demonstrated timely and efficient communication via email and other messaging apps. Their company culture and understanding approach are exemplary.

Clutch
5.0/5.0
Curved left line
We're Here to Help

Looking for consultation? Can't find the perfect match? Let's connect!

Drop me a line with your requirements, or let's lock in a call to find the right expert for your project.

Curved right line